HTTP与HTTPS区别 输入www.baidu.com的过程 每次HTTP都经过TCP吗 HashMap数据结构 HashMap什么时候扩容,扩容时间复杂度 Redis Zset数据结构 Zset依据什么排序 进程与线程区别 进程间通信 进程切换时都有哪些改变 进程切换时操作系统做了什么 算法题 合并区间 岛屿数量 反问 面试官没开摄像头,感觉纯纯的KPI😂 更新,约二面了(9.15) 二面
#字节跳动# Golang面试,共4轮面试 一面∶ Q:1.自我介绍 Q:2.你有后端开发的经验吗?主要用什么语言做开发? Q:3.那你了解Java的设计模式有哪些呢? Q:4.那你写个单例我看看。为什么这么写?为什么要用volatile和synchronized Q:5.计网的基础怎么样?说说tcp的四次挥手。close_wait是哪一方的状态? Q:6.了解mysql吗?说说事务? Q
由于我本人没有记录全部问题的习惯,以下面经中的问题都是我回忆起来的一部分。 字节 一、项目 1.微服务注册与发现机制? 2.服务之间的通信? 3.负载均衡实现方式?原理? 4.项目中是否用到MYSQL调优?细说 5.实习项目 二、八股 1.线程之间的通信方式? 2.Java的notify()底层实现原理? 3.equals与==与hashcode 4.equals没有重写,调用时会调用hashco
7.29号--一面 一个小姐姐面试 自我介绍 1.点赞幂等如何保证? 2.分布式学了什么? 3.分布式解决什么问题而提出来的? 4.做分布式有什么麻烦?需要考虑把服务拆成微服务,那么维护,设计需要考虑什么问题? 5.分布式服务数据之间的流通?(这一部分分布式确实不知道回答什么 -。-,看我不太了解分布式果断终止话题,换其它) 6.spring框架用到了什么底层思想,如何实现的,有用到哪些比较
自我介绍 选一个项目进行介绍,介绍项目中的难点和解决方案 先做一道算法题,岛屿数量(思路正确,但是dfs一开始紧张写错地方了,后面经过提醒测试过了) 计算机网络:udp与tcp的区别,udp怎么实现像tcp一样的可靠传输???拥塞控制的实现(我按照tcp握手思路答不对,应该是要基于udp本身的协议,不太了解底层协议,GG) 异步io,同步io和非阻塞io的区别 进程与线程的区别,进程用的堆栈情况,
字节: 1.项目介绍 2.java的容器有哪些,说说map类型的数据结构除了hashmap,如果想要有序遍历map可以如何使用,采用那种数据结构,问hashtable是怎么保证线程安全的,加的锁属于什么锁,这个锁封锁粒度是多少 3.谈谈redis索引,B+数据结构为什么用于索引,不用红黑树,如果让你查询你觉得查询次数两种数据结构次数是不是相同 4.redis支持的数据类型,说说zset的底层数据结
等12点笔试结束后更新代码 第一题 堆金字塔,每块石头长1m,宽1m,按cm计算,给你金字塔的高度n层,然后从1-n给你n个列表,每个列表代表第i层的石头放的位置,如果一个石头左右两边都有石头垫着,或者中心点下面有别的石头,就能稳定,否则就会掉落,上方依赖他的石头也会跟着掉落,问最终只剩下几个石头。 思路: 模拟,因为本身有序,每层的石头掉落情况是依赖于他底下一层石头的剩余情况,按层判断每个石头是
卧槽 节! 第一题 AC 金字塔 方块的宽和高都是1,单位是m;不存在重叠的方块 输入: n表示金字塔的层数,接下来n行,第 i 行表示第 i 层 第一个数m,表示这行有m个方块的左边缘的起始位置p[j] 单位是cm 默认递增 输出: 剩余的方块个数 方块存在至少要满足一个条件: 在第一层 重心在之前一层的方块上 左边缘和右边缘都在之前一层的方块上 不满足条件的方块可认为直接消失 数据范围: 1
金字塔累方块 数组保存一层可放置的方块左端点 放置新一层是,符合三种情况之一则可以放置 地面层 重心落于上一层的方块区间内 左右端点同时落于上一层的方块区间内 由于每一层保存的端点为有序的,因此判断一点是否落于一层的区间用的二分 只过了92%,可能哪里没处理好 神奇序列 dp0[i]保存以0结尾的最长神奇序列长度 dp1[i]保存以1结尾的最长神奇序列长度 ASDF 假设字串长度为4n,则字频应该
自己简单记录一下 1.堆金字塔,用二分优化了一下,AC 2.神奇序列,AC 3.ASDF,滑动窗口划过去,有个样例没过,但一交AC了 4.做书架,不知道用啥,暴力了... #字节笔试##字节跳动23秋招笔试心得体会#
1、聊了好久的项目,你是怎么做的? 2、多租户除了你这种解法,你还有其他的解法吗? 3、数据库的主从复制? 4、http请求get、put、post、delete的区别? 5、http请求如何认证的啊?(项目里衍生出来的) 6、数据库的delete、drop和truncate有什么区别? 面试官小哥哥太有礼貌了,太温柔了,这是面试体验最好的面试官了!!! 算法题:给你一个json输出他的叶子节点,
算法题,leetcode301 重排链表 飞书发起视频会议,有域名,怎么转换到ip的 网络中数据包的传输流程,具体。比如从大连到北京,是怎么传输的 场景题,飞书群里发红包,限制人数,限制总额,随机红包,给出设计方案 算法题 一个蚂蚁在12点的刻度上,可以向右走也可以向左走,走了n步最终回到12点,求有几种走法。让说思路(说了一个不对,没想出来,结束面试,寄) 还是太菜 #字节跳动#
楼主字节跳动正式批笔试冲突没做,挂了,然后被其他部门捞起来面试。 首先是一上来自我介绍,然后是写一道算法题。 写的是实现LRU,不许使用LinkedHashMap,允许使用HashMap和链表,链表要求自己实现,实现复杂度是O(1) 然后是面试官问几个项目,疯狂怼细节。 问到登录时用JWT,JWT能够保证安全性吗,各种问JWT的细节。 问到去中心化处理是怎么处理的(关于blockchain的)。
9月2日一面 9月7日二面 9月13日三面 9月14日hr面 9月21日意向 补充:一面当天通知过了、二面隔天通知过了、三面也是当天通知过了。 --------------------------------------------------------------------------------------------------- 字节Data二面57min 介绍一下研究成果?解决的问题
字节电商提前批一面挂 7.20 听说字节电商几乎没hc,居然过了简历筛选,很意外(实际上是很惨,因为面评可能比较烂,后面再也没有字节的面试了)。不过很感谢字节,给我练手的机会,大二找实习的时候也是一面挂。。。 1.介绍实习项目 2.MySQL怎么实现可重复读 3.Java实现同步的手段有哪些 4.聊聊开源项目 5.算法题 搜索矩阵(我直接说出了最优解,但是面试官觉得不行,得用二分,然后我开始怀疑自